In May, to commemorate #YouthREXat10, we hosted an online event featuring Dr. Bianca Baldridge, who presented Precarity and Promise: Youth Work as the Process of Futuring, drawing from her book Laboring in the Shadows: Precarity and Promise in Black Youth Work.
The conversation explored the significance, challenges, and possibilities of youth work, and the conditions needed to sustain youth work as a process of futuring.
Call-In-Cards for
Anti-Black Racism Action
The Call-In-Cards centre critical self-reflexivity as the source and impetus to connect understandings of anti-Black racism to anti-Black racism action.
Four decks of cards across four themes feature 16 scenarios with four prompts that guide critical self-reflexivity to support anti-Black racism action.

Data Hub by YouthREX!
The Data Hub provides the community sector with accessible data about Ontario youth that highlight and focus attention on trends and issues about young people. Data can be powerful tools to inform practices, programs, services, and policies that are more responsive to the unique and distinct experiences of Ontario’s youth.
RESEARCH PROJECT
The Ontario Youth Sector Compass
The Ontario Youth Sector Compass is a research project focused on understanding the experiences of young people and youth workers in Ontario.
